WebGluten is a protein naturally found in some grains including wheat, barley, and rye. It acts like a binder, holding food together and adding a “stretchy” quality—think of a pizza maker tossing and stretching out a ball of dough. Without gluten, the dough would rip easily. Other grains that contain gluten are wheat berries, spelt, durum ...

Although wheat is mandated to be labelled through FALCPA as it is one of the big eight allergenic sources, … WebSymptoms of wheat allergy: swelling and/or itching of the mouth or throat. Hives and/or rashes. Headaches. Congestion. GI issues. Anaphylactic shock. Allergies, including those to wheat, are associated with positive IgE assays. Diagnosis is made through skin prick tests, wheat-specific IgE blood testing and a food challenge.
